This year’s RCNi Nurse Awards will take place next week, with inspiring nurses from across the UK being recognised for their exceptional work.

The event, which is taking place virtually for the first time, will showcase the incredible compassion, care, bravery and innovation of extraordinary people working in the nursing profession.

Awards acknowledge nurses’ enormous contribution during COVID-19 pandemic

Our 67 finalists in categories ranging from Team of the Year to Mental Health Nursing and Commitment to Carers have been chosen from more than 700 nominees.

The presentation of the awards for all 12 categories will occur throughout the week, Monday 5 October to Thursday 8 October, starting at 6pm each evening except Thursday.

The announcements will begin with the Child Health Award at 6pm on Monday.

In addition to the 12 category winners, the RCN Nurse of the Year will be announced on the final evening, with a video premiere stream on RCNi's Facebook page from 8pm on Thursday 8 October.

The awards will acknowledge the enormous contribution of nurses during the COVID-19 global pandemic, in the International Year of the Nurse and Midwife, including tributes to those who have lost their lives.

‘A chance to celebrate the achievements of nurses’

RCNi managing director Rachel Armitage says: ‘No one could have predicted just how much this really would be the Year of the Nurse and Midwife.  

‘We believe the time is right to showcase the professionalism, clinical expertise and compassionate care delivered by the nursing team to patients UK-wide every day of every year.

‘The RCNi Nurse Awards 2020 are a chance to celebrate these achievements, as well as recognise nursing’s exceptional contribution to the COVID-19 response and those who have lost their lives.’

The diverse list of finalists includes a nurse who saved a fellow passenger’s life on a long-haul flight when he went into cardiac arrest, a nurse who drew on her own childhood experience of sleeping rough to support homeless people, and a team that has set up a dedicated support wing for prisoners with learning difficulties and autism.
